The world of retail is evolving rapidly, and shopping malls are at the forefront of this transformation. As consumer behavior shifts, mall branding strategies have had to adapt, embracing innovative technology, immersive experiences, and sustainability. In 2025, mall branding has reached a new level, integrating digital advancements and personalized experiences to attract and retain shoppers. Let’s explore the key trends shaping mall branding this year.
1. The Rise of Experiential Branding
Traditional shopping malls were primarily transactional
spaces, but 2025 has seen a shift towards experiential branding. Malls are now
destinations that offer more than just retail therapy—they provide
entertainment, social engagement, and interactive experiences. From pop-up
installations to augmented reality (AR) shopping experiences, brands are
creating environments that encourage customers to spend more time and build
stronger connections with their favorite retailers.
2. Digital Integration and Smart Technology
Malls in 2025 leverage smart technology to enhance customer
experiences and streamline operations. Digital kiosks, AI-powered shopping
assistants, and interactive store directories have become standard features.
Personalized marketing powered by artificial intelligence helps brands reach
customers with relevant offers, while virtual try-on solutions allow shoppers
to see how clothes or accessories look before making a purchase.
3. Sustainability and Eco-Conscious Branding
Environmental concerns continue to shape consumer choices,
and malls are responding with eco-friendly initiatives. Green malls with
energy-efficient lighting, water conservation systems, and recycling programs
have gained popularity. Brands that prioritize sustainable sourcing, zero-waste
policies, and ethical production methods are leading the way in mall branding.
Eco-conscious consumers in 2025 gravitate toward malls that demonstrate a
genuine commitment to sustainability.
4. Social Media-Driven Engagement
Social media remains a powerful tool for mall branding in
2025. Malls are leveraging influencer partnerships, live-streamed shopping
events, and user-generated content to drive foot traffic and online engagement.
Hashtag campaigns, AR filters, and gamified shopping experiences keep customers
engaged, while interactive social walls in malls display real-time posts from
shoppers, creating a sense of community.
5. Hyper-Personalization and Data-Driven Marketing
Personalized shopping experiences have reached new heights
in 2025. Malls use data analytics and artificial intelligence to understand
customer preferences and shopping patterns. Personalized push notifications,
exclusive membership perks, and AI-curated product recommendations ensure that
every visit to the mall feels tailor-made. Loyalty programs powered by
blockchain technology provide shoppers with secure and transparent rewards,
fostering long-term engagement.
6. Hybrid Retail Spaces and Omnichannel Experiences
The line between online and offline shopping continues to
blur. In 2025, malls feature hybrid retail spaces that serve as both physical
stores and fulfillment centers for online orders. Brands are adopting
omnichannel strategies, allowing customers to order online and pick up in-store
or experience seamless returns and exchanges. This integration ensures
convenience, catering to the modern consumer’s demand for flexibility.
7. Themed and Niche Malls
A growing trend in 2025 is the rise of themed and niche
malls catering to specific audiences. Luxury malls, high-tech hubs, and
wellness-focused shopping centers are gaining popularity. These specialized
malls offer curated brand selections, events, and experiences tailored to their
target demographics, ensuring a more meaningful and engaging shopping journey.
